Using the study leader’s collection of pre-Columbian and ethnographic art as a teaching vehicle, the course will explore the evolution of collecting as an endeavor; the nature of pre-Columbian and ethnographic art distinguishing it from other art forms; the psychological, social and cultural functions and context of pre-Columbian and ethnographic art; the cultures creating the art; the art itself; and the moral, legal, authenticity and market considerations associated with the collection of pre-Columbian and ethnographic art.
